USEFUL INFORMATION ON DOHA Official Name: State of Qatar Capital City: Doha Population: 1.7 million National Day: 18 December Main Towns: Al Wakra, Al Rayyan, Al Khor, Dukhan, Mesaied, Ras Laffan, Al Shamal, Umm Salal. Shopping In addition to the souks where visitors can shop for traditional handicrafts, the city of Doha has many modern shopping malls that offer everything from tourist favourites such as gold ornaments to international brands that are available at boutique stores. Qatar is one of the most dynamic economies in the Middle East. It has undergone remarkable economic and social development over the last 20 years. With an attractive business environment and a progressive national leadership, the country continues to be one of the fastest growing economies in the region. Shopping hours are generally Saturday to Thursday from 9:00 to 12:00 and 16:00 to 19:00 or later. Shopping malls are usually open from 9:00 until 22:00. Fridays is the traditional day off even though many shopping malls are open from late afternoon until 22:00. Climate Doha enjoys sunshine almost every day of the year. April is expected to be warm and pleasant with outside temperatures ranging from 15 to 25 degrees Celsius. Code Of Conduct Qatar is an Islamic country and as a courtesy visitors should dress modestly. Swimwear is accepted on private beaches or by private pools but should not be worn around town. Public displays of affection between men and women are discouraged and if deemed to infringe on moral values can be a punishable offence. Alcohol may be purchased and consumed only on licensed premises. Drinking and driving is a serious offence and the country has zero tolerance towards drugs. Getting Around You can find numerous taxis on the streets, unmistakable because of their ocean-like turquoise colour. In addition, all the city s hotels are serviced by an additional fleet of unmarked sedans. While they often tend to run at prearranged rates, many of them have meters too which are hidden cleverly in the driver s rear-view mirror. Time zone GMT + 3 hours in winter; GMT +2 hours in summer; Qatar does not use daylight saving hours. 8 9

Electricity Electricity is provided at 240 volts at 50 hertz. Wall sockets are square with three pins. Hotels and serviced appartments generally supply adaptors but they can also be found in most supermarkets and corner stores. Water The tap water in Doha is distilled. However it is advisable to drink bottled water which is widely available. Language Arabic is the official language. However English is commonly used as a second language. Banking and currency exchange Qatar uses the Riyal (QAR) as its currency unit which is divided into 100 dirhams. Notes in circulation are in denominations of 1, 5, 10, 50, 100 and 500. 1 EUR= approximately 5.00 QAR 1 US$= approximately 3.65 QAR Major credit cards are accepted in just about all shops, restaurant and hotels.
